Table II.—Cases of Infectious Disease Notified During the Year 1920, including Cases which OCCURRED in Central Home, Union Road, Whipps Cross Hospital, &c., but NOT those Imported.
NOTIFIABLE DISEASE. | Number of Cases Notified. | Total Cases Notified in each Locality--Wards. | Total Cases removed to Hospital. | |||||||||||||||
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
At all Ages. | At Ages—Years. | 1 | 2 | 3 | 4 | 5 | 6 | 7 | 8 | 9 | ||||||||
Under 1. | 1 and under 5. | 5 and under 15. | 15 and under 25. | 25 and under 45. | 45 and under 65. | 65 and upwards. | Leyton. | Lea Bridge. | Central. | Forest. | Leytonstone | Grove Green. | Harrow Green. | Cann Hall. | Wanstead Slip. | |||
Small Pox | 1 | ... | ... | 1 |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| 1 | ... | ... | 1 |
Cholera (C) Plague (P) |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... |
*Diphtheria (including Membranous Croup) | 354 | 3 | 92 | 209 | 31 | 18 | 1 | ... | 11 | 80 | 53 | 47 | 24 | 41 | 50 | 34 | 14 | 228 |
†("Erysipelas | 57 | 3 | 1 | 5 | 3 | 20 | 17 | 8 | 5 | 9 | 8 | 3 | 6 | 5 | 8 | 8 | 5 | 21 |
‡Scarlet Fever | 450 | 2 | 55 | 334 | 48 | 11 | ... | ... | 22 | 59 | 88 | 56 | 33 | 45 | 46 | 70 | 31 | 197 |
Typhus Fever |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... |
§Enteric Fever | ... | ... | 1 | 2 | 3 | 1 | ... | 2 | ... | 2 | 2 | ... | ... | 1 | ... | ... | 5 | |
Relapsing Fever (R) Continued Fever (C) |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... |
║Puerperal Fever | 6 | ... | ... | ... | ... | 4 | ... | ... | ... | ... | 2 | ... | 1 | 1 | ... | 2 | ... | 5 |
Cerebro-spinal Meningitis | 1 |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| 1 |
Poliomyelitis | 2 | ... | 2 |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| 1 | ... | ... | ... | ... | l | ... | ... | ... | 2 |
Encephalitis Lethargica | 1 | ... | ... | 1 |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| 1 |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| 1 |
¶Pulmonary Tuberculosis | 168 | ... | 1 | 15 | 50 | 71 | 27 | 4 | 14 | 25 | 32 | 27 | 13 | 11 | 28 | 7 | 11 | 39 |
**Other forms of Tuberculosis | 48 | ... | 3 | 17 | 15 | 9 | 3 | 1 | 5 | 4 | 8 | 3 | 8 | 7 | 7 | 2 | 4 | 15 |
Ophthalmia Neonatorum | 15 | 15 |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| 1 | 4 | 3 | 1 | 1 | ... | 2 | ... | 3 | 3 |
†† Pneumonia | 100 | 1 | 9 | 19 | 16 | 33 | 17 | 5 | 17 | 16 | 23 | 7 | 6 | 6 | 13 | 3 | 9 | 54 |
‡‡Malaria | 20 | ... | ... | ... | 5 | 14 | 1 | ... | 5 | 2 | 7 | 1 | ... | ... | ... | 2 | 3 | ... |
§§Dysentery | 4 | ... | ... | ... | 1 | 3 | ... | ... | ... | ... | 2 | ... | 1 | ... | 1 | ... | ... | ... |
Anthrax | 1 | ... | ... | ... | ... | 1 |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| ... | 1 | ... | 1 |
Totals | 1235 | 24 | 163 | 602 | 174 | 187 | 67 | 18 | 83 | 199 | 229 | 147 | 93 | 117 | 158 | 129 | 80 | 573 |
* 8 cases occurred in Whipps Cross Hospital (3 on Staff), 1 in Central Home, Union Road and 5 in Bethnal Green Schools. ‡‡ Old military cases.
† 5 cases occurred in Central Home, Union Road. §§ Old military cases.
‡ 2 cases occurred in Bethnal Green Schools. 1 in Forest Lodge Convalescent Home, 6 in Whipps Cross Hospital (Staff), 6 in West Ham Union Home, 60, Davies
Lane, and 1 in Central Home, Union Road. 1 case proved not to be scarlet fever, 1 case withdrawn.
§ 1 case occurred in Whipps Cross Hospital. || 1 case from Bermondsey (notified from Nursing Home, 19, Holly Road).
¶ 3 cases occurred in Central Home, Union Road, 1 in Whipps Cross Hospital (Nurse), and 1 in Bethnal Green Schools.
** 1 case occurred in Bethnal Green Schools. †† 2 cases occurred in Central Home, Union Road.
